1.1 What Are Sciatic Nerve Glides?
Sciatic nerve glides are gentle exercises designed to mobilize the sciatic nerve, reducing tension and improving its mobility. They involve specific movements that stretch and glide the nerve along its path from the lower back to the legs. These exercises are categorized into tensioners, which apply a controlled stretch to the nerve, and sliders, which enhance nerve movement without excessive tension. By targeting the nerve’s pathway, sciatic nerve glides help alleviate pain, numbness, and tingling associated with sciatica. They are often recommended by physical therapists as a non-invasive approach to managing nerve-related discomfort and promoting long-term recovery. Regular practice can provide immediate relief and support overall nerve health.

2.1 Structure and Function of the Sciatic Nerve
The sciatic nerve is the largest nerve in the human body, measuring up to 2cm in diameter. It originates from the lumbosacral nerve roots (L4-S3) in the lower back. This nerve extends down both legs, responsible for controlling muscle movements and transmitting sensory information. Its two components, the tibial and common peroneal nerves, regulate motor and sensory functions in the lower limbs. Compression or irritation of the sciatic nerve can lead to pain, numbness, or weakness, often associated with sciatica. Understanding its structure and function is essential for effective management and relief through techniques like nerve glides.
2.2 Common Causes of Sciatic Nerve Compression
Sciatic nerve compression often results from structural issues in the lower back or pelvis. Herniated discs, spinal stenosis, or spondylolisthesis can compress the nerve roots. Piriformis syndrome, where the piriformis muscle tightens and irritates the nerve, is another common cause. Poor posture, prolonged sitting, or repetitive movements can also contribute. Additionally, degenerative conditions like arthritis or obesity may increase pressure on the sciatic nerve. Understanding these causes helps in addressing the root of the issue, making exercises like nerve glides more effective in relieving pain and restoring mobility.

3.1 Tensioners: Stretching the Sciatic Nerve
Tensioners are exercises that apply gentle stretch to the sciatic nerve, reducing inflammation and relieving pain. They involve extending the leg while keeping the spine stable, such as lifting one leg straight up and bending the ankle. These stretches target the nerve’s tightness and promote healing. Regular practice improves nerve mobility and alleviates discomfort. Tensioners are often recommended for acute pain management and should be performed gently, holding each stretch for 10-15 seconds. They are an essential part of sciatic nerve glide routines, offering both immediate relief and long-term benefits when done consistently.
3.2 Sliders: Promoting Nerve Mobility
Sliders are exercises designed to enhance the sciatic nerve’s mobility by guiding it through gentle, controlled movements. Unlike tensioners, sliders do not stretch the nerve but instead focus on improving its ability to glide within surrounding tissues. These exercises often involve subtle ankle and foot movements, such as pointing and flexing the foot while the leg remains straight. Sliders are particularly effective for chronic sciatica, as they address nerve adhesions and restrictions without causing additional strain. Regular practice helps restore normal nerve function, reducing stiffness and discomfort. Sliders are a complementary technique to tensioners, offering a holistic approach to sciatic nerve health and pain management.

4.1 Supine Sciatic Nerve Glide
Lie on your back with knees slightly bent. Bend one hip to 90 degrees, lifting the leg straight up. Gently bend the ankle forward and backward, stretching the back of the leg. Hold for 3 seconds and breathe, repeating 3 times. This exercise targets the sciatic nerve, relieving tension and improving mobility. Perform 12-15 repetitions daily, ensuring smooth, controlled movements to avoid discomfort. If pain occurs, stop immediately. This glide is effective for alleviating sciatica symptoms and enhancing nerve flexibility when done consistently and correctly.
4.2 Seated Sciatic Nerve Glide
Sit upright with feet flat on the floor. Extend one leg straight, keeping the knee straight, and flex the foot toward your head. Tilt your head gently toward the extended leg, holding for 10 seconds. Release slowly and repeat 3 times. This seated glide targets nerve tension, improving sciatic nerve mobility. Perform 2-3 sets daily for optimal results. Focus on gentle, controlled movements to avoid discomfort. Regular practice helps reduce inflammation and promotes healing, enhancing overall nerve function and alleviating sciatica symptoms effectively. This exercise is ideal for those with limited mobility or preference for seated activities.

6.1 Piriformis Stretch (Figure Four)
The piriformis stretch, often referred to as Figure Four, targets the piriformis muscle, which can compress the sciatic nerve. To perform this stretch, lie on your back, bend one knee, and cross the ankle of the opposite leg over the bent knee. Gently push the knee of the crossed leg toward your chest until a stretch is felt in the back of the buttock. Hold the stretch for 15-30 seconds and repeat 3 times on each side. This exercise helps relieve tension in the piriformis muscle, reducing pressure on the sciatic nerve and alleviating pain. Regular practice can improve mobility and prevent sciatica flare-ups.
6.2 Peroneal Nerve Glides
Peroneal nerve glides target the peroneal nerve, a branch of the sciatic nerve, to improve mobility and reduce compression. Start in a seated position with your knee straight. Slowly curl your toes, then point your foot (plantarflexion). Next, maintain this position while moving your ankle in and out (inversion/eversion). Stop when you feel tension in your foot or leg. Hold for 10 seconds and repeat 3-5 times. This exercise helps relieve numbness, tingling, and pain in the lower leg and foot. Regular practice can enhance nerve function and reduce sciatica symptoms by promoting proper nerve movement and reducing irritation.
6.3 Hamstring and Calf Stretching
Hamstring and calf stretches complement sciatic nerve glides by improving flexibility and reducing muscle tightness. To stretch the hamstrings, sit on the floor with legs extended. Lean forward gently, reaching for your toes, and hold for 15-20 seconds. For the calves, stand facing a wall with one hand on it. Step one foot back, keeping the heel on the ground, and bend the front knee. Hold for 15-20 seconds and switch legs. These stretches relieve tension in the muscles surrounding the sciatic nerve, enhancing its mobility and reducing discomfort. Regular stretching can prevent muscle imbalances and improve overall lower limb function, supporting sciatica relief and long-term recovery.

8.1 Contraindications for Sciatic Nerve Glides
Sciatic nerve glides may not be suitable for everyone. Individuals with acute sciatica, recent injuries, or severe nerve damage should avoid these exercises. Conditions like spinal fractures, tumors, or cauda equina syndrome require medical intervention and are contraindications. Additionally, those experiencing intense pain or numbness should consult a healthcare professional before starting. Improper technique or overstretching can worsen symptoms, so guidance from a physiotherapist is essential. Always prioritize medical advice to ensure safe and effective practice.
8.2 Modifying Exercises Based on Pain Levels
When performing sciatic nerve glides, it’s crucial to adjust the exercises according to individual pain levels. If pain is severe, start with gentle movements and gradual stretches. For those with acute pain, consider shorter holds and fewer repetitions to avoid exacerbating symptoms. As pain subsides, intensity and duration can be increased. If certain positions worsen discomfort, modify or avoid them. Consulting a physiotherapist can provide personalized adjustments, ensuring exercises are both safe and effective. The goal is to balance progress with comfort, fostering healing without causing further irritation.

9.1 Recommended Frequency and Duration
For optimal results, perform sciatic nerve glides 2-3 times daily, with each session lasting 10-15 minutes. Start with shorter durations and gradually increase as comfort allows. Hold each glide position for 10-15 seconds, repeating 3-5 times per session. Consistency is key; aim to practice regularly to maintain nerve mobility and prevent flare-ups. Over time, you can extend the duration of each session as the exercises become a comfortable part of your routine. Regular practice helps manage pain effectively and supports long-term nerve health.
